Originally Posted by xoz,Sep 4 2010, 04:59 AM
Interesting as MY06 I thought came tape less, mine did and I put tape on for now as I have a CF HT, If I paint I'll just take it off.
With MY00 I removed the factory tape (its tedious) but came out perfect underneath. So I guess its hit and miss.
have pics of MY 06 taping if you want to see, its very easy especially if you trace out to get the correct fit. btw my tape is the 3m di noc vinyl.
For the US, they didn't come tapeless till 2008.
